Marketplace for Monitoring Services
First Claim
1. A system comprising:
- a processor;
a database comprising a plurality of monitoring services providers;
a connection initiator operating on said processor, said connection initiator that;
receives a solution definition defining an application, monitored parameters, and an output results definition;
identifies a first monitoring service;
defines a first configuration for said first monitoring service;
a connection manager that;
configures said first monitoring service;
establishes a communication channel for said first monitoring service;
causes said first monitoring service to collect said monitored parameters according to said output results definition.
2 Assignments
0 Petitions
Accused Products
Abstract
A marketplace for monitoring services providers may configure and deploy monitoring and other services that meet a solution definition for a given application. The services may include monitoring and tracing, analysis, rendering, debugging, optimizing, load generating, and other solution providers. The solution definition may include a schema or other data definitions for parameters gathered during application execution, as well as definitions for parameters or solutions that may be desired. The marketplace may identify those services that may be configured to meet the solution definition, then configure and deploy the selected services. A financial clearinghouse may handle financial payments to the various service providers.
-
Citations
16 Claims
-
1. A system comprising:
-
a processor; a database comprising a plurality of monitoring services providers; a connection initiator operating on said processor, said connection initiator that; receives a solution definition defining an application, monitored parameters, and an output results definition; identifies a first monitoring service; defines a first configuration for said first monitoring service; a connection manager that; configures said first monitoring service; establishes a communication channel for said first monitoring service; causes said first monitoring service to collect said monitored parameters according to said output results definition.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A method performed on a computer processor, said method comprising:
-
receiving a solution definition defining an application, monitored parameters, and an output results definition; identifying a first monitoring service; defining a first configuration for said first monitoring service; configuring said first monitoring service with said first configuration; establishing a communication channel for said first monitoring service; causing said first monitoring service to collect said monitored parameters according to said output results definition. - View Dependent Claims (13, 14, 15, 16)
-
Specification